Job Description

Hitachi Rail is looking an enthusiastic and self-motivated Signaling System Engineerwho thrives in a fast paced environment. This role located on-site in Mississauga, Ontario CA.

Accountabilities
  • Ensure the identification, the management and the traceability of Overall Signaling System Requirements for the entire life cycle of the project (Design and Testing)
  • Ensure the apportionment of Overall Signaling System requirements to each of the subsystems which constitute the Signaling system.
  • Ensure the Signaling System Design and ATC Gap Analysis from a define version to achieve proper Signaling System Functionalities and performances.
  • Ensure the identification, management and resolution of all the interfaces between the Signaling Subsystem and the Other Subsystems (e.g. Rolling Stock, TLC) as well as the internal interfaces within the Signaling Subsystem.
  • Ensure the definition of the Physical Architecture of the Signaling part and Integrate it within the Overall Physical Architecture of the overall System.
  • Ensure that the Development of the Products complies with the Requirements and Interfaces of a project.
  • Ensure the delivery of the assigned tasks on time, on budget and quality.
  • Ensure efficiency and standardization of signaling systems across different projects (e.g. Design specifications).
  • Ensure the definition of signaling system integration test procedures, the implementation of any requested test improvement, the execution of such tests and the preparation of final test dossier.
  • Ensure the definition of lab test procedures, the implementation of any requested test improvement, the execution of such tests and the preparation of final test dossier
  • Understands and integrates applicable CMMI, CENELEC, AREMA, IEEE, IPC, etc standards.
  • Responsible for the Engineering Solution
